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at addressing issues related to a building’s foundation stability.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and slab jacking, which work to reinforce and stabilize the existing foundation structure. The goal is to prevent further shifting or settling that could compromise the integrity of the property. Professionals assess the specific conditions of the foundation and determine the most appropriate stabilization method to restore stability and support the building’s weight effectively.
These services help solve a variety of foundation-related problems, including uneven floors, visible cracks in walls and ceilings, and doors or windows that no longer open and close properly. Foundation settling can be ca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. Larger or more complex projects in Cuyahoga Falls may reach higher costs.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ific conditions.
Material and Equipment Fees - Costs for materials and specialized equipment usually account for a significant portion of the total, often ranging from $1,000 to $5,000. The price varies based on the stabilization method and site requ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for foundation stabilization services generally fall between $2,000 and $8,000. The duration and complexity of the project influence the overall labor charges in local markets.
Additional Service Charges - Extra costs may include permits, inspections, or site preparation, typically adding $500 to $2,000. These fees vary depending on local regulations and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Pier and Beam Stabilization providers focus on supporting and leveling structures with pier and beam systems to prevent further movement and structural damage.
Slab Repair and Stabilization contractors specialize in reinforcing or lifting concrete slabs that have shifted or cracked, helping to restore stability to the foundation.
Soil Stabilization services involve improving soil conditions around a foundation to reduce settling and shifting, often through specialized injection techniques or compaction methods.
Foundation Underpinning experts offer underpinning solutions to strengthen and stabilize foundations that have become compromised due to soil movement or other factors.
Crack Repair and Reinforcement specialists focus on sealing and reinforcing cracks in foundations to prevent further deterioration and maintain structural integrity.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ques used by professionals to reinforce and restore the stability of a building's foundation, helping to prevent further settling or cracking.
How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ically include underpinning, piering, or foam jacking, which aim to evenly distribute weight and support the foundation's structure.
What signs indicate the need for foundation stabilization?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and noticeable shifts in the building's structure.
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ally applicable to various foundation types, including conc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and basements, depending on the specific issue.
